diff --git a/lib/telegram-driver/sinks.js b/lib/telegram-driver/sinks.js index 9d89f8f..b7b2b92 100644 --- a/lib/telegram-driver/sinks.js +++ b/lib/telegram-driver/sinks.js @@ -37,7 +37,7 @@ var broadcast = exports.broadcast = (0, _ramda.curryN)(2, function () { chat_id: (0, _ramda.defaultTo)((0, _ramda.path)(['message', 'chat', 'id'], update)), text: (0, _ramda.defaultTo)('Null-catch: no text provided'), reply_markup: JSON.stringify - }, options) + }, (0, _ramda.is)(String, options) ? { text: options } : options) }); }); @@ -549,37 +549,27 @@ var answerCallbackQuery = exports.answerCallbackQuery = (0, _ramda.curryN)(2, fu }); var editMessageText = exports.editMessageText = (0, _ramda.curryN)(2, function () { - var _ref20 = arguments.length <= 0 || arguments[0] === undefined ? {} : arguments[0]; - - var text = _ref20.text; - var _ref20$parse_mode = _ref20.parse_mode; - var parse_mode = _ref20$parse_mode === undefined ? null : _ref20$parse_mode; - var _ref20$disable_web_pa = _ref20.disable_web_page_preview; - var disable_web_page_preview = _ref20$disable_web_pa === undefined ? null : _ref20$disable_web_pa; - var _ref20$reply_markup = _ref20.reply_markup; - var reply_markup = _ref20$reply_markup === undefined ? null : _ref20$reply_markup; + var options = arguments.length <= 0 || arguments[0] === undefined ? {} : arguments[0]; var update = arguments[1]; - - var options = { - text: text, - parse_mode: parse_mode, - disable_web_page_preview: disable_web_page_preview, - reply_markup: reply_markup - }; return (0, _types.Request)({ type: 'sink', method: 'editMessageText', - options: options + options: (0, _helpers.defaults)({ + chat_id: (0, _ramda.defaultTo)((0, _ramda.path)(['message', 'chat', 'id'], update)), + message_id: (0, _ramda.defaultTo)((0, _ramda.path)(['message', 'message_id'], update)), + text: (0, _ramda.defaultTo)('Null-catch: no text provided'), + reply_markup: JSON.stringify + }, options) }); }); var editMessageCaption = exports.editMessageCaption = (0, _ramda.curryN)(2, function () { - var _ref21 = arguments.length <= 0 || arguments[0] === undefined ? {} : arguments[0]; + var _ref20 = arguments.length <= 0 || arguments[0] === undefined ? {} : arguments[0]; - var _ref21$caption = _ref21.caption; - var caption = _ref21$caption === undefined ? null : _ref21$caption; - var _ref21$reply_markup = _ref21.reply_markup; - var reply_markup = _ref21$reply_markup === undefined ? null : _ref21$reply_markup; + var _ref20$caption = _ref20.caption; + var caption = _ref20$caption === undefined ? null : _ref20$caption; + var _ref20$reply_markup = _ref20.reply_markup; + var reply_markup = _ref20$reply_markup === undefined ? null : _ref20$reply_markup; var update = arguments[1]; var options = { @@ -594,10 +584,10 @@ var editMessageCaption = exports.editMessageCaption = (0, _ramda.curryN)(2, func }); var editMessageReplyMarkup = exports.editMessageReplyMarkup = (0, _ramda.curryN)(2, function () { - var _ref22 = arguments.length <= 0 || arguments[0] === undefined ? {} : arguments[0]; + var _ref21 = arguments.length <= 0 || arguments[0] === undefined ? {} : arguments[0]; - var _ref22$reply_markup = _ref22.reply_markup; - var reply_markup = _ref22$reply_markup === undefined ? null : _ref22$reply_markup; + var _ref21$reply_markup = _ref21.reply_markup; + var reply_markup = _ref21$reply_markup === undefined ? null : _ref21$reply_markup; var update = arguments[1]; var options = { @@ -609,4 +599,4 @@ var editMessageReplyMarkup = exports.editMessageReplyMarkup = (0, _ramda.curryN) options: options }); }); -//# sourceMappingURL=data:application/json;base64, \ No newline at end of file +//# sourceMappingURL=data:application/json;base64, \ No newline at end of file